About Keld

Keld is a wonderfully scenic area at the head of Swalesdale. It is a lonely landscape with a small hamlet of stone cottages and outlying farms. It lies at the crossing point for both the Pennine Way and the Coast to Coast Walk, thus it of great appeal to walkers, hikers and ramblers.

On the River Swale which flows at the edge of Keld, visitors can see a series of four waterfalls thundering through a spectacular limestone gorge. There are also some lovely wooded areas.

The hamlet has no shop, nor does it have a pub, but it is a grand area for walking or relaxing. There is a choice of accommodation in the region which includes scattered bed and breakfast houses and holiday cottages.

Keld lies between High Seat (710 ft.) and Rogan's Seat (672 ft.). A short distance away if the famous Buttertubs Pass, a scenic route, ending with the dramatic waterfall known as Hardrow Force.

The nearest large town is the lovely old market town of Hawes where you will find a museum and the closeby National Park Centre.
